Abstract

We investigate the speed at which the character Ken Masters, from Street Fighter, must perform his Shoryuken move in order for flames to ignite on his fist. It was found that he would need to punch upward at Mach 1.96, or 672.28 m/s. Furthermore, he would experience 13163.26 g’s and would need to consume 100 servings of spaghetti bolognese (Ken’s favourite meal) for the energy required to perform the move.
